Client Experience Specialist & Scheduler
Mosaic Georgia, Inc.
Job Description
Responsibilities
• Greet and assist clients, visitors, and professionals upon arrival
• Answer and route phone calls and emails; take accurate messages
• Provide a warm, trauma-informed experience for all guests and clients
• Monitor visitor access and uphold security procedures
• Act as first point of contact for client concerns or special needs
• Coordinate appointments for forensic interviews and medical exams
• Manage shared calendars and confirm availability with internal teams and external partners
• Cancel, reschedule, and notify relevant parties as needed
• Identify and document client needs, including but not limited to transportation, interpretation, and accessibility accommodations
• Receive and process referrals for services
• Input and maintain client data in systems such as Salesforce and Collaborate
• Prepare and distribute mail, faxes, and packages
• Maintain office supplies and equipment; coordinate vendor communications
• Assist with document preparation, filing, and database maintenance
• Perform regular office tidiness checks and work-related errands (e.g., post office)
• Ensure all meetings and events are properly posted on shared calendars
• Schedule and support meetings and conference room usage
• Assist with planning and execution of organizational events (refreshments, sign-in, nametags)
RE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S
• Bilingual (English/Spanish) – REQUIRED
• High School Diploma or equivalent; business technical training preferred
• Strong computer skills including MS Office, Outlook/Teams, and internet communication tools
• Experience in administrative support, scheduling, or client services
